Trace in Time
  • Series
  • Lists
    Books Music Podcasts Projects
  • About
  • Contact
Search posts...

Obsidian

A collection of 1 Post

New

How I Use Obsidian as a Thinking Studio

How I configured Obsidian as a developer's personal thinking studio — vault structure, web clipper, key plugins, and the PKM ideas behind each decision.

01 Apr, 2026
PKM Obsidian

PKM

A collection of 1 Post

New

How I Use Obsidian as a Thinking Studio

How I configured Obsidian as a developer's personal thinking studio — vault structure, web clipper, key plugins, and the PKM ideas behind each decision.

01 Apr, 2026
PKM Obsidian

Reflections

A collection of 4 Posts

The Pattern Loop: How the Brain Automates Behavior and How to Interrupt It

Your brain runs on automatic behavior loops. Learn to map your triggers, understand pattern synchronization, and interrupt the cycle with intentional action.

18 Nov, 2025
Reflections

Assumptions in Relationships: How Silence Becomes Conflict

Most tension in relationships grows from silence, not conflict. A study in assumption, imagination, and why directness is the shortest path to clarity.

14 Nov, 2025
Reflections

Hesitation: What It Is, When It Helps, and When It Doesn't

Hesitation isn't just fear - it's a signal. This essay examines when the pause protects you, when it traps you, and how to act decisively without rushing.

28 Oct, 2025
Reflections

Goals and Needs: Why Ambition Fails Without the Right Foundation

Goals that ignore real needs always collapse. Sort out want from need from desire - then design goals that fit your actual life, not your ideal version of it.

27 Oct, 2025
Reflections

dotnet

A collection of 1 Post

New

Hot Path: How to Identify and Optimize It in .NET

A hot path is code that runs on every request — small inefficiencies there compound into P99 spikes users actually feel. How to find hot paths with profilers and fix them in .NET.

30 Mar, 2026
dotnet performance

observability

A collection of 1 Post

New

P50, P95, P99, and the Average: What Latency Numbers Actually Tell You

Average response time hides the worst user experiences. P99 can run 100× slower than P50 on the same dataset. What P50, P95, and P99 mean, why they matter, and how to read them together.

30 Mar, 2026
performance observability

performance

A collection of 2 Posts

New

Hot Path: How to Identify and Optimize It in .NET

A hot path is code that runs on every request — small inefficiencies there compound into P99 spikes users actually feel. How to find hot paths with profilers and fix them in .NET.

30 Mar, 2026
dotnet performance
New

P50, P95, P99, and the Average: What Latency Numbers Actually Tell You

Average response time hides the worst user experiences. P99 can run 100× slower than P50 on the same dataset. What P50, P95, and P99 mean, why they matter, and how to read them together.

30 Mar, 2026
performance observability

Follow Along

Topics

Reflections performance observability dotnet PKM Obsidian

Trace in Time

Here, I share what I build, photograph, and learn along the way — thoughts on keeping creativity alive inside a structured life. You’ll find reflections, tools, and methods that help me stay focused without losing curiosity. Dive in, and maybe you’ll find something that resonates.

Recent Posts

How I Use Obsidian as a Thinking Studio

01 Apr, 2026

Hot Path: How to Identify and Optimize It in .NET

30 Mar, 2026

P50, P95, P99, and the Average: What Latency Numbers Actually Tell You

30 Mar, 2026

Menu

Series About Contact

Lists

Books Music Podcasts Projects
2026 © Trace in Time.